The Design Right (Proceedings before Comptroller)(Amendment) (No. 2) Rules 1990
Made
Laid before Parliament
Coming into force
The Secretary of State, in exercise of the powers conferred upon him by section 250 of the Copyright, Designs and Patents Act 19881, with the consent of the Treasury pursuant to subsection (3) of that section as to the fees prescribed under these Rules and after consultation with the Council on Tribunals in accordance with section 10(1) of the Tribunal and Inquiries Act 19712, hereby makes the following Rules:—
1.
These Rules may be cited as the Design Right (Proceedings before Comptroller) (Amendment) (No. 2) Rules 1990 and shall come into force on 10th September 1990.
2.
The Design Right (Proceedings before Comptroller) Rules 19893 are amended by substituting for Schedule 2 thereto the Schedule set out in the Schedule to these Rules.

SCHEDULE 2FEES
1.On reference of dispute (Form 1) under rule 3(1) | £54 |
2.On application (Form 2) under rule 7(1) | £30 |
3.On application (Form 3) under rule 10(1) | £54 |
4.On application (Form 4) under rule 14(1) | £54 |
(This note is not part of the Rules)
These Rules replace Schedule 2 to the Design Right (Proceedings before Comptroller) Rules 1989 to increase (by 8 per cent) from £50 to £54 the fees for the matters referred to in items 1, 3 and 4.
